Known issues

  • Before you install security update 890175 (MS05-001), you must install critical update 811630 for some operating systems. For these operating systems, installing critical update 811630 after installing security update 890175 might cause reduced functionality in HTML Help if security update 890175 is later uninstalled.

    Note The reduced HTML Help functionality occurs only if security update 890175 is uninstalled. For additional information about this issue, click the following article number to view the article in the Microsoft Knowledge Base:

    892641 HTML Help files do not work correctly after you uninstall security update 890175 (MS05-001)

  • Certain kinds of Web-based programs may not function correctly after you install security update 890175. For more information about this issue, click the following article number to view the article in the Microsoft Knowledge Base:

    892675 Certain Web sites and HTML Help features may not work after you install security update 896358 or security update 890175
